The Role of Mathematics in Gambling

At its core, gambling is underpinned by mathematical principles that dictate the odds of winning and the house edge. Understanding these concepts is crucial for anyone looking to approach gambling with a clear perspective. Probability theory, for instance, governs the likelihood of different outcomes in games like roulette, blackjack, or slot machines. In the UK, where the Gambling Commission regulates all licensed operators, games are designed to ensure a predictable issue to player (RTP) percentage over time. This substance that while short-term wins are possible, the long-term expectation is that the house retains a small percentage of all stakes. Similarly, in sports betting, odds reflect the implied probability of an event occurring, with the bookmaker’s margin built into the prices. For example, a coin flip in a fair game has a 50% chance, but in betting markets, the odds might imply a 52% chance to account for the margin. Recognising this mathematical fabric helps players make informed decisions, avoid chasing losses, and understand that no strategy can overcome the constitutional reward over extended play. Educational resources from organisations like GamCare and BeGambleAware emphasise this point, encouraging a focus on entertainment rather than profit.

The Social and Cultural Context of Gambling in the UK has a long history, from horse racing to the National Lottery, and is deeply embedded in British culture. However, its social implications are complex and often debated. On one hand, gambling can be a form of social entertainment, with friends gathering for a poker night or colleagues placing friendly bets on football matches. On the other hand, problem gambling can lead to financial hardship, relationship breakdown, and mental health issues. The UK government has taken steps to address these concerns, such as introducing a mandatory levy on operators to fund research, education, and treatment. The Gambling Act 2005 and its subsequent reviews aim to balance personal freedom with harm reduction. For instance, the introduction of stake limits for fixed-odds betting terminals (FOBTs) in 2019 was a significant regulatory change. Understanding this social context is important for players to recognise when gambling shifts from a harmless pastime to a harmful behaviour. Community initiatives, like local support groups and online forums, provide avenues for discussion and help, while the NHS now offers specialist clinics for gambling addiction. The cultural acceptance of gambling in the UK does not diminish the need for responsible practices, and players are encouraged to set time and money limits, use self-exclusion tools like GAMSTOP, and never gamble with money they cannot afford to lose.
